26
18
56
58
24
43
14
19
47
115
119
254
149
98
79
60
169
240
148
128
94
89
312
32
70
151
649
41
165
122
133
62
147
57
152
37
85
75
113
67
150
218
171
172
50
231
76
208
125
187
146
59
29